What is Value Added Distributors LLC?

Value Added Distributors LLC is a company that specializes in distributing products and providing additional services that enhance the value of those products for customers. These services may include technical support, product customization, inventory management, and logistics solutions. The company acts as an intermediary between manufacturers and end users, helping streamline the supply chain and improve customer satisfaction through tailored solutions.

Position Summary

Gustave A. Larson Company is the Midwest, Plains, and Mountain States leading wholesale distributor of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ration (HVACR) equipment, parts, and supplies. Our business philosophy is to focus on serving the needs of our customers, with a value-added, professional, and enthusiastic attitude.

We provide service advice, support, and training for the products we sell across the country, but will be focused in the following states: Idaho, Utah, Wyoming, Colorado, and New Mexico. Those products include, but are not limited to Trane, American Standard, Mitsubishi, Emerson, Heatcraft, Magic-Pak, Hydronic products, etc. The Service Advisor has a significant amount of customer interaction, and the role will, therefore, demand a high level of customer service. Additionally, the ideal candidate will possess both technical and business expertise in order to excel in this role.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Perform Service advice and guidance on phone and or in person if necessary.
  • Help control warranty costs.
  • Training
    • Assist with developing and presenting product application, installation, and service programs.
    • Support Sales Consultants and Store Managers with individual dealer training.
    • Play an active role in the construction of educational newsletters, memos, etc.
  • Help manage service and parts operations at our branch levels.
  • Perform equipment inspections, local, and remote locations.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
  • Effectively handle multiple priorities, organize workload, and meet deadlines.
  • Methods, techniques, parts, tools, and materials used in the maintenance and repair, including testing, diagnosis, HVAC and Refrigeration service.
  • HVACR equipment and servicing methods.
  • Must be able to read and explain detailed wiring and piping diagrams.
  • Dealer Business Process and Best Practice.
  • Skilled the use of computers, MS Office, Manufactures intranet systems, etc.
  • Must use appropriate telephone etiquette.
  • Must be able to stand in front of an assembly and educate.

Education

  • Degree or Certificate in HVACR or equivalent experience preferred.
  • Service Advisor experience preferred.
  • NATE Certification to repair furnaces, A/C systems desired.
